Technical Field

The invention relates to a sports car, in particular to a sports car with a single-rack soot blower.

Background

The existing single-rack soot blower roadster often has a serious field of worm wheel abrasion, so that the soot blower roadster cannot normally run. Three reasons are considered: 1. enough lubricating oil is not filled in the reduction gearbox of the sports car (no obvious scale on the reduction gearbox shows that the lubricating oil is sufficient), and the lubricating oil is consumed after the reduction gearbox runs for a period of time, so that the abrasion is serious; 2. scrap iron or impurities are arranged in the reduction gearbox of the sports car, and the worm wheel is abraded in the meshing process along with the adhesion of lubricating oil on the worm wheel during the running of the sports car; 3. lubricating oil is not filled before the sports car runs, and the worm wheel is directly shaved off as the worm wheel is made of copper and is softer than the worm.

Compared with the prior art, the invention has the beneficial effects that:

the invention has made improvement to the worm gear abrasion problem, one is to increase the transparent oil level gauge as the container to store lubricating oil, there are oil mass scales on the upper surface, in the course of filling lubricating oil, lubricating oil is filled to the corresponding oil mass scale, guarantee the lubricating oil that is filled is just right, the capacity is sufficient but not wasted, before the soot blower will be run, observe whether there is lubricating oil at the oil level gauge first, then run the soot blower, prevent the oil-free run of the sports car; secondly, the case shell at the turbine accommodating part is made into a cylindrical shape, so that scrap iron or impurities are brought to the lower part of the other side end by lubricating oil under the condition that the position right below the worm wheel is not the lowest position, the scrap iron or the impurities are prevented from being adhered to the turbine all the time (when the position below the turbine is the lowest position, the scrap iron is accumulated at the lowest position, and the scrap iron can be adhered to the turbine repeatedly when the turbine rotates), the abrasion is generated when the turbine operates, and the impurities in the case shell can be removed when the lubricating oil is changed; and thirdly, a ventilating device is added at the top of the reduction gearbox, so that the air pressure generated by overheat operation in the shell of the sports car is prevented from acting on a worm gear, and the worm gear is excessively worn. In addition, the oil level gauge is also provided with an oil level alarm device, after lubricating oil is injected into the oil level gauge, the floating plate floats on the surface of the lubricating oil, the signal baffle shields a shielding signal between the infrared emission lamp and the infrared receiving lamp, when the lubricating oil is used and the oil level is reduced, the floating plate descends along with the liquid level, when the liquid level of the lubricating oil is reduced to a certain degree, the signal baffle does not shield the infrared emission lamp any more, the infrared receiving lamp receives the infrared signal, the signal is converted into the action of a buzzer or other alarm devices through an additionally arranged processor, an alarm is given out, a worker is reminded of filling the lubricating oil in time, and the reduction gearbox is prevented.

Referring to fig. 1-2, the present invention provides a technical solution: the utility model provides a sports car of single rack soot blower, including motor 1 and the reducing gear box 2 of being connected with motor 1, be equipped with in the reducing gear box 2 and be used for the worm wheel and the worm that slow down, the lower part that reducing gear box 2 faced motor 1 one side is established to cylindric structure 3 and is used for holding the turbine, and the bottom of this cylindric structure 3 is less than the bottom of reducing gear box 2 other side, the top of reducing gear box 2 is established and is used for outside carminative breather, the front of reducing gear box 2 is established oiling mouth 4, oiling mouth 4 department establishes oil level gauge 5 connected with it, establish in the oil level gauge 5 and be used for the oil seepage hole to between turbine and the worm between the oil seepage hole, here oil level gauge 5 is as the container that is used for storing lubricating oil, lubricating oil that its inside was stored permeates through the oil seepage hole and realizes the lubrication action between the worm.

In another embodiment, the oil level indicator 5 is a vertically-arranged transparent container which is embedded in the wall of the front surface of the reduction gearbox 2, the oil filling port 4 is arranged at the upper part of the front surface of the oil level indicator 5, and the front surface of the oil level indicator 5 is marked with oil volume scales.

In another embodiment, the ventilation device comprises an exhaust port 6 arranged on the top surface of the reduction gearbox 2 and a sliding blocking cover 7 forming a shield on the exhaust port 6, the sliding blocking cover 7 can slide on the top surface of the reduction gearbox 2 under the action of a power mechanism so as to move away from the exhaust port 6, the power mechanism can be an air cylinder or other devices, when the ventilation device is used, the ventilation device is matched with a time relay, and the ventilation device acts once at intervals, so that the exhaust port 6 cannot be opened frequently, corrosion or pollution caused when corrosive or smoke dust and the like possibly existing in the working environment of the soot blower enters the reduction gearbox is avoided, and hot air is gathered at the top in the reduction gearbox at intervals and is rapidly exhausted after the exhaust port 6 is opened.

In another embodiment, a dust screen is provided on the exhaust port 6.

In another embodiment, an oil quantity alarm mechanism is provided in the oil level gauge 5, and specifically includes:

a floating plate 8 horizontally disposed in the oil level gauge 5;

a plurality of sliding blocks 9 which are slidably arranged on the inner walls of the left side and the right side of the oil level indicator 5, wherein the sliding blocks 9 are connected with the floating plate 8 through frame rods 10;

the infrared transmitting lamp 11 and the infrared receiving lamp 12 are oppositely arranged on the inner walls of the left side and the right side of the oil level indicator 5 and are positioned above the highest point where the sliding block 9 can slide;

and the signal baffle 13 is vertically arranged on the floating plate 8 and is vertical to the connecting line of the infrared emission lamp 11 and the infrared receiving lamp 12.

Through oil mass alarm mechanism, the oil mass is when enough, and signal baffle 13 keeps off between infrared emission lamp 11 and infrared receiving lamp 12, and the signal can not transmit, and when the oil mass descends until not enough, signal baffle descends along with the kickboard, no longer shelters from signal transmission, then signal is received to infrared receiving lamp to with this signal feedback to treater, send out the police dispatch newspaper through treater control buzzer or other devices, remind the staff in time to annotate lubricating oil.
